Support for multiple HttpClientCallback, where the callback itself decides if
it handles the request

Improve the HttpClientCallback security mechanism, so that multiple callback
implementations can be registered by default, and each callback can "decide" if
they'll handle the request or not. This should allow implementations for
different types of clients to intercept a request, based on other criteria than
the request's path.
